■ The ECCO FEI World Championships 2022 for dressage, jumping, vaulting and Para riders, held in Herning, Denmark, during August, led to a significant medal haul for Great Britain’s riders, with 11 won in total — the highest tally that was equalled only by the Netherlands.
Dressage rider Lottie Fry led the way for the Brits with two individual golds — in the grand prix special and the grand prix freestyle — aboard Van Olst Horses’ mesmerising black stallion Glamourdale (main picture). Lottie and her teammates (Charlotte Dujardin, Gareth Hughes and Richard Davison) also collected a team silver medal behind the host nation, Denmark.
